Universal line voltage single-stage AC/DC converter

Summary:Single-stage AC/DC power converters are an advisable solution to
meet the regulations for low frequency harmonics (such as EN61000-3-2)
at lower cost compared with the two-stage approach. The main challenge
is the use of this type of converter in universal line voltage
applications. In this paper, a single-stage AC/DC power converter
capable of operating with a universal input voltage range is proposed.
The main difference with other proposals is that the storage capacitor
of this converter holds a voltage equal to the line voltage and it does
not penalize the voltage stress on the circuit. An experimental
prototype confirms this result
